What roofing materials work best for homes in Chassahowitzka?
+
For homes near the coast in Chassahowitzka, metal roofing (especially aluminum or Galvalume-coated steel) is one of the best choices because of its resistance to salt air corrosion, high winds, and heavy rain. If you prefer the look of traditional shingles, we recommend algae-resistant, impact-rated asphalt shingles designed for Florida’s climate. Tile roofing is another strong option that holds up well in coastal conditions. The best material for your specific home depends on the roof’s pitch, the structural capacity of the framing, and your budget, so we always start with an inspection before making a recommendation.
What should I look for when hiring a roofer in Chassahowitzka?
+
Start by verifying that the contractor is licensed and insured in the state of Florida. Ask for their license number and check it with the Florida Department of Business and Professional Regulation. You should also ask for references from recent jobs in the Chassahowitzka or Citrus County area, look at online reviews, and make sure they offer a written warranty on both materials and labor. Be cautious of storm chasers who show up after hurricanes offering low-cost repairs. These out-of-town operators often do substandard work and disappear before problems surface. Do I need a permit for roof work in Chassahowitzka?
+
Yes. Citrus County requires a building permit for most roofing work, including full roof replacements and significant repairs. The permit process makes sure your new roof meets the Florida Building Code, which includes specific requirements for wind resistance, underlayment, and fastener patterns based on your location within the county. How do I start a roof insurance claim in Chassahowitzka after storm damage?
+
Contact your insurance company as soon as possible after the damage occurs and file a claim. Before you call, take photos of any visible damage from the ground (don’t climb on the roof yourself). Then schedule an inspection with a licensed roofing contractor like Protech. We’ll document the damage thoroughly with photos and a written report that supports your claim. Your insurance company will send an adjuster to inspect the roof, and we can be present during that visit to make sure nothing is missed. Can my family stay in the house during a roof replacement in Chassahowitzka?
+
In most cases, yes. Your family can stay in the home while we replace the roof. The work is done from the outside, so the interior of your home isn’t directly affected. That said, the process is noisy, and there will be debris and equipment around the exterior of the house during the project. We take precautions to protect your landscaping and property, and we perform a thorough cleanup at the end of each work day, including magnetic sweeps to pick up stray nails from the yard and driveway. If the project involves structural repairs to the decking that could temporarily expose the interior to the elements, we’ll let you know in advance so you can make arrangements.
